Break Free From The Prison!

A king, angry with his prime minister sentenced him to be confined to a tower where there was no way of escape. Jumping from the tower would simply mean death. The minister while being taken away whispered something to his wife.
On the very first night of the confinement, the wife left an insect to crawl up the tower. She applied some honey to its antennae and tied a thin silk thread to its tail. The insect slowly crawled its way to the 300 ft tower in search of honey.
No sooner did the minister spotted it, he grabbed the silk thread tied to the insect, to which a cord was attached and to the cord in turn, a strong rope was attached by his wife. The minister caught hold of the rope and made his way out of the prison. Not only did he escape from the prison, he always learnt the way to free himself from the eternal prison.
Osho says that even the slightest hint or the smallest way can lead one to the ultimate liberation if grasped with zest.
